GS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

1,969 of the 6,860 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Goldman Sachs (GS)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$91.6B — up 24% from $74.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 291 funds opened new GS positions and 89 closed out — a net gain of 202 holders — while 660 added to existing stakes and 750 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$2.05B. The largest seller was Janus Henderson Group, cutting an estimated $302M.
